Learning from Greensboro: Truth and Reconciliation in the United States

Lisa Magarrell and Joya Wesley. Foreword by Bongani Finca

304 pages | 6 x 9 | 10 illus.

Cloth 2008 | ISBN 978-0-8122-4110-5 | $49.95 | £32.50

A volume in the Pennsylvania Studies in Human Rights series

Learning from GreensboroAn insider's look at the Greensboro Truth and Reconciliation Commission's process, strategic choices, challenges, and context, Learning from Greensboro tells the story of how one U.S. community struggled to come to terms with events in its past and model truth-seeking as a tool for addressing the country's legacy of racist violence.
